I have removed all CC and still had this problem in base-game. It is infuriating that, even after spamming the shower, that Sims will refuse to do anything because they have reached such a negative mood. For me, hygiene is affected with this. After working out, My Sim's hygiene bar went into the red, so I had her take lots of showers. But it didn't work. Right now she has maxed the hygiene bar and the bar is still red-coloured, she is covered in dirt and is complaining about it, and has the "Filthy" moodlet.
This is now happening to multiple Sims. The most recent Sim it happened to bladder failed. Her Hygiene is now maxed but she is still miserable. This is affecting gameplay. I hope someone can find a fix soon.

Try resetting your user files as described in the factory reset described in this post: http://answers.ea.com/t5/The-Sims-4/FAQ-Troubleshooting-Steps-amp-Known-Issues/m-p/3621199
You won't loose anything. Just make sure to not delete any files and make a backup.
After renaming your folder, repair the game through Origin
Try on a new game with nothing added back first (start new game). If it works, put back your save game and try again. If it still works, you can start putting stuff back.
- Options.ini (or just re-set all your settings manually)
- Tray Folder
- Screenshots/Videos/Custom music
- Rest of the save games (leave out slot_00000001.save which is the autosave)
- Custom content like clothing, hair, skins, make up ....
- Mods (one by one, making sure they all still work)
The rest does not need putting back, cause they are mostly cache files that recreate or log files that are not needed for the game.
Just something to try if this ever happens to someone again. I had a sims that was showing hungry all the time and I removed him from the household and into another house. I saved the game then added him back and so far it has not happened again. I just thought I would pass this information on for future reference.
